À propos de cet audio
Bryan DeBois, Director of Industrial AI at Rovisys, is sharing the real-world applications of AI in manufacturing. Learn more about the limitations of generative AI like ChatGPT on the plant floor, the potential of autonomous AI for decision-making, and the importance of data readiness for successful AI implementation. Plus, Bryan discusses the future of work and how AI can actually enhance human capabilities.
Watch now to hear Bryan share:
Generative AI like ChatGPT is powerful but not yet suitable for the complex, real-time decision-making required in manufacturing.
Autonomous AI, similar to self-driving cars, is the key to unlocking AI's potential on the plant floor.
Manufacturers face significant challenges with data silos and lack of integration, hindering AI adoption.
AI is not about replacing humans but empowering them to focus on higher-value tasks.
The future of AI lies in enhancing human capabilities and improving our quality of life.
